Output 31b86c8795302a6fecdaea2b254e7cb8a48c4288ca132528d2c7a442afb81123:1

value
99929616
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ffaeb956ecc41917238c2235a474263fc429919a OP_EQUALVERIFY OP_CHECKSIG
address
1QJvcxDBop3GpbFJpTk8GNFRYdFbomrSQH
transaction
31b86c8795302a6fecdaea2b254e7cb8a48c4288ca132528d2c7a442afb81123
spent
true